An official copy is the definitive, court-admissible record of who owns a registered property, the extent of the land on the title plan, and the rights, covenants and charges affecting it. We obtain it directly from HM Land Registry and send you the official PDF.

What you'll receive
You'll receive two official PDFs: the register (typically 3–6 pages: current owner, price paid, rights, restrictions and charges) and the title plan (usually 2 pages, the official map with the boundary edged in red). It does not include the older scanned deeds such as the signed mortgage deed, transfers or conveyances. Those are separate documents; see the Deeds Pack.

What's the difference between the register and the title plan?
The register is the written record: owner, price paid, mortgages, covenants and restrictions. The title plan is the official map showing the registered boundary. Register + plan together is the £15 option.
